A behavior disorder may be diagnosed when these disruptive behaviors are uncommon for the … WebThe inappropriate behavior is explained to the child, who is told to sit in the time-out chair or is led there if necessary. The child should sit in the chair for 1 minute for each year of age (a maximum of 5 minutes). Physical restraints should be avoided.

WebSome behaviours that families commonly find challenging include: defiance (e.g. refusing to follow your requests) fussiness (e.g. refusal to eat certain foods or wear certain clothes) hurting other people (e.g. biting, kicking) excessive anger when the child doesn’t get their own way tantrums. WebJan 8, 2024 · Some children find it difficult to distinguish acceptable and unacceptable behaviour. This lovely activity supports this understanding by making the actions very visual. Children should sort the pictures into two sets and then discuss their choices.
